Reusing solar panels has some major benefits. For beginners, it helps reduce the amount of waste that is being sent to land fills or incinerators. Not just does this benefit the atmosphere by lowering pollution, however it can additionally save money in disposal fees as well as useful resources such as steels or glass. Additionally, recycling photovoltaic panels allows for products that were once thought about pointless to be repurposed right into brand-new items. Recycled materials can additionally be utilized to create less costly versions of brand-new solar panels, making them more easily accessible for people who might not have had the ability to afford them before.
The disadvantage of recycling photovoltaic panels is that there is usually a lack of framework in place for appropriately throwing away old ones. In some cases, this indicates that harmful materials are launched right into the setting throughout production or disassembly procedures which can create health and wellness risks for those living close by. In addition, recyclers might not constantly have the ability to recuperate all components from taken down panels as a result of their age or problem which could result in more ecological issues due to incorrect disposal techniques.

Among the largest issues with recycling solar panels is the intricacy of the task itself. It can be challenging to break down the different components, such as glass and steel, to be reused separately. Furthermore, photovoltaic panel makers usually have a mix of materials made use of in their items which makes sorting them even more complicated. Moreover, there are security and wellness threats involved with taking care of damaged glass or breathing in fumes from melting components.

To start with, numerous business have applied a 'take-back' system where old or broken photovoltaic panels can be collected and sent to their corresponding factories for reusing. By doing this, the materials are able to be reused in the building of new items. Furthermore, some districts have even begun offering incentives for people wishing to recycle their solar panels; this might vary from tax breaks to cost-free delivery costs.
On top of that, technology has come to be significantly innovative when it involves recycling photovoltaic panels-- with specialist machines efficient in separating out all the different parts within them. For example, by using AI-powered robot arms, these devices can draw out beneficial products such as copper and aluminium while additionally dealing with contaminated materials safely.
